On January 27, 2010, the Blue Cross and Blue Shield Association announced the expansion of its Blue Distinction designation program to include Blue Distinction Centers for Spine SurgerySM and Blue Distinction Centers for Knee and Hip ReplacementSM. These Centers joint the Blue Distinction Centers for Bariatric Surgery, Cardiac Care, and Complex and Rare Cancers, and Blue Distinction Centers for Transplants currently available to Service Benefit Plan members.

Blue Distinction designations are awarded to facilities that have demonstrated a commitment to quality care by meeting objective, evidence-based thresholds for clinical quality and safety developed with input from expert clinicians and leading professional organizations. These new designations will help provide patients and their physicians with a credible means of selecting facilities that meet their individual health care needs.

The addition of these two new designations brings the total number of Blue Distinction designations to more than 1,600 nationwide, in 46 states and the District of Columbia.
